Our Home For Exchange

Description of the home we are offering for exchange

Our adobe-style desert retreat is calm, comfortable, casual, and clean. This spacious single level home includes a principal bedroom with a king bed, ensuite with two vanities, and a separate tub and shower. On the other side of the house is another bedroom with queen bed, a third room (the writer's studio) with a desk and a futon for relaxing, and bath with a shower/tub.

The open-concept great room has 14' ceilings and includes the kitchen, dining area, and lounge area with a Southwestern fireplace. There's also a cozy TV entertainment room, a shady back patio and a charming front courtyard with Santa Fe gate. We've retained all the native desert plants including saguaro cacti on this almost-an-acre lot. There is plenty of parking in the circular drive and 2-car garage. There are pleasant mountain and desert views in every direction.

This is the place if you want easy access to Saguaro National Park West, Tucson Mountain Park, and like to hike, bike, golf, hit the casino, stargaze, watch birds, and relax in natural desert surroundings. There is a fully equipped kitchen for preparing meals, whether healthy or indulgent. Or, skip the dishes and try one of Tucson's famous restaurants (from casual to fine dining) in the first U.S. destination named a UNESCO City of Gastronomy.

Home has 3 TVs and wifi internet. Programming includes 37 Local TV channels plus a Roku device for streaming TV. Or bring your own Amazon Fire Stick, Roku, Apple TV, or laptop computer and connect to our TVs. A DVD/CD player with DVD collection, and Sony audio system complete the entertainment system. There is great mobile phone coverage from a nearby cell tower.

World famous attractions are close by: 15 minutes to Arizona-Sonora Desert Museum and Saguaro National Park West. 5 minutes to the Tucson Mountain Park. 20 minutes to San Xavier del Bac Mission built in 1797. 5 minutes to the Tucson Trap & Skeet Club. The renowned University of Arizona is an easy 25 minutes away with a multitude of cultural offerings including theater, music, museums, sports events and so much more. The excellent Tucson International Airport is 25 minutes away, and commuter airport Ryan Airfield is even closer.

There is so much to do in Tucson!

Our guests have especially enjoyed golfing, cycling, touring Biosphere 2, Titan Missile Silo, Pima Air & Space Museum, Tucson Museum of Art & Historic Block, Casino Del Sol, Kitt Peak Observatory, Mt. Lemmon Sky Center, and the largest airplane boneyard in the world.

Popular day trips include the historic mining town of Bisbee and Tombstone, where you can see a re-creation of the shoot-out at the OK Corral, Kartchner Caverns State Park and Organ Pipe Cactus National Monument. Bird watchers "flock" to Madera Canyon and Patagonia.

Tucson, Arizona is one of the nine cities worldwide honored as a 2017 World Festival & Event City. Highlighted events include the strange and beautiful All-Souls Procession, El Tour de Tucson bicycle race, the annual Tucson Gem & Mineral Show, and one of the world's great book fairs, the Tucson Festival of Books.

The sunrises are inspiring, and the sunsets are spectacular. Tucson has both excellent air quality and gorgeous weather all year long, and the brilliant winter days are sunny and warm, with average highs of 70°F or 20°C. Money Magazine Aug 2018 named Tucson as one of the 10 Best Vacation Values and nearby Saguaro National Park one of the 10 Best National Parks for Your Money.

We think you will enjoy Tucson as much as we do!

Neighbourhood

Description of our neighbourhood and surrounding area

Unique rural neighborhood where you might spot mountain deer, javelinas, hawks, quail, coyotes, cowgirls on horseback. Large lot sizes. Wide flat roads are fun to explore on bicycle, but a car is a must for getting out and about. Mix of retirees and families. Surrounding area includes virgin desert, retirement villages, and small ranches. Area is growing, with new shopping and dining options adding monthly. Views include Golden Gate Peak in the Tucson Mountains, Kitt Peak to the west, and gorgeous starry nights as Tucson has a "Dark Skies" ordinance that limits night-time light pollution.
